We’ve been answering business phones since 2007

CloudSecretary is the US service of Yo Respondo Telesecretariado S.L., a European answering company founded in 2007. The same operation handles more than 44,000 calls a month for over 800 active clients with 15 in-house receptionists. CloudSecretary brings that operation to US businesses, in English and Spanish.

Why the US, and why now

Two reasons, and the second is the honest one.

The service translates. A business that loses calls loses them the same way in Madrid and in Miami. The problem doesn’t change with the country; the language does.

Bilingual is the whole point. In the US, "press 2 for Spanish" is the industry standard, and it’s where callers hang up. Answering both languages in the same seat, on the same number, with the same person, is something a European operator that has always worked in Spanish can do without building a second team.

So CloudSecretary is not a translation of the Spanish site. Different brand, different market, different pricing, and a service built around the one thing this operation was already good at.

How we work

Decisions already made, all of them checkable:

A person on every call. No AI voice agent, at any hour, on any plan. Software writes the summary; it never speaks to your caller. The longer argument.

Two languages, one seat. English and Spanish handled by the same receptionist on the same number. No menu, no transfer, no surcharge. How it works.

We don’t record calls. The service is answering, message taking and scheduling — recordings aren’t part of it and aren’t switched on by default. What we do hold.

One answered call, one price. Not per minute. Booking, transferring and escalating are part of the call. Pricing.
